Sexual orientation Employment Equality Sexual Orientation Regulations 2003 These regulations outlaw discrimination direct discrimination, indirect discrimination, harassment and victimisation in employment and vocational training on the grounds of sexual orientation. Sex Discrimination Gender Reassignment Regulations 1999 These regulations are a measure to prevent discrimination against transsexual people, on the grounds of sex, in pay and treatment in employment and vocational training.
